Emotional Freedom Technique

Emotional Freedom Technique (EFT) is an alternative treatment for managing emotional and physical blocks. It is rooted in various theories of alternative medicine, including acupuncture, neuro-linguistic programming, energy medicine, and Thought Field Therapy.

Mindset Coaches, healers and energy workers that utilise this technique believe that tapping on specific points on the body can create balance within the body’s energy system and help reduce physical and emotional distress. According to its creator, Gary Craig, an energy disruption is the underlying cause of negative emotions and pain.

Though further research is required to substantiate its efficacy, EFT tapping is increasingly used to help people suffering from anxiety and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D).

In terms of definition, EFT is an energy psychology method that relies on the principles of ancient Chinese alternative medicine, particularly acupressure. It requires the patient to tap on a sequence of points on the body while repeating a particular phrase – usually an affirmation devised with their coach – to bring about therapeutic healing, which may take a long time using other methods.
